titleOfInvention Sealant for liquid crystal dropping method, vertical conduction material, and liquid crystal display element
abstract When a liquid crystal cell produced by bonding substrates under reduced pressure is used for manufacturing a liquid crystal display element by a dripping method, the sealant pattern may be deformed or broken even when taken out under a normal pressure environment. Provided are a liquid crystal dropping method sealing agent, a vertical conduction material, and a liquid crystal display element that do not occur. A sealing agent for a liquid crystal dropping method containing a curable resin component and a solid component, wherein the viscosity measured by an E-type viscometer at 25 ° C. and 1.0 rpm is (a) (Pa · s). ), And when the weight ratio of the solid component is (b) (wt%), (a / b) is in the range of 9.5 to 35, and the curable resin component includes at least the following ( For a liquid crystal dropping method containing 15 to 30% by weight of a curable resin satisfying 1) or (2) and having a sample breaking time of 100 seconds or more measured by an extensional viscosity measurement method (A) using laser light Sealing agent. (1) The viscosity measured with an E-type viscometer under the conditions of 25 ° C. and 1.0 rpm is 800 Pa · s or more. (2) Solid at 25 ° C. [Selection figure] None
